In the JDK launcher, there is a codepath which would set/modify the 
LD_LIBRARY_PATH. This happens unconditionally on AIX and Linux/musl and can 
also happen on other Linux platforms if an LD_LIBRARY_PATH is pre-set which 
contains a libjvm.so.

The LD_LIBRARY_PATH is set to $JVMPATH:$JDK/lib:$JDK/../lib. The last part of 
this, $JDK/../lib, seems to be a remnant of times when there was a jre 
subfolder in a JDK deployment. So it should likely be removed.
